Having a few I have to say that they are impressive. True they run more than say Reaper but the sculpting is of an extremely high quality. The problem is that they are closer to 32mm than 28, hence they tend not to fit in, but if you need specialty figures, Ladies in waiting, a few heroic figures, they're great.

The figures are fantastic and based on what Martin actually intended them to look like (unlike the clueless HBO art department).

Unfortunetly they are too large for any other range of gaming figures. The company occassionaly considers making a range that is "game" useful.

My strong suggestion is to contact them, praise the figures but point out we would all buy a lot more if they could be used with other gaming figures (like Perry plastics). Urge them to create a similar line in 28mm.
